I could read your posts for days.I will always be a Haney fan ......He really didn't have any genetic elite guys to compete against in his era ...Christian was the only one size and ht wise that matched up , but he didn't have the wheels or thickness. If Rory , mendenhall , or jeff king had made it to the IFBB they would have pushed him more , but like Srydom they just couldn't match Haneys back and chest thickness . Haney's back genes were probably the best ever .....although Coleman and yates ended up with freakier backs ........
I still remember in 86 being 16 driving nearly 3 hrs to see Haney do a Seminar at the old San jose Golds [ great hardcore gym for a long time ] and someone asked if they could measure Haneys arm .....he said sure .......he said he was 270 and his arm cold ended up 20 and half ...Which is huge with no seo , today with how guys do it he 'd have had 22s at least ....lol ...And man was his upper chest thick ....like a dam shelf .....[ my upper chest sucks so seeing guys like that freaks me out ] ......only denis james and ruhel had upper chest shelves to that degree ......insane ...
Hey G , didn't you say you saw Victor rhichards measured in his prime at an event ....do you remember what his measurements were ..........I have seen him in and out of the gym multiple times .....I bet he was 330 in decent shape at his largest .....prob 23 inch arms....just thick ....his legs might have been like ramys in that 36 range ......lol ....I remember and muscle and fitness measuring him at like 22 and 32 and half but that was at 275 in near show shape .....he was a thick beast .....way way thicker than Haney .....but no way could have he beat him on stage .....
I like gym bbers .....I am huge fan of pretty physiques .....but guys that are huge and strong in the gym wear it is earned always inspired me
Nasser was very thick ....from head to toe ......Mevin Anthony 's back in a tank top was unreal .....I never saw many of the east coast guys train [ other than guys that were at Venice or in San Diego .....] Never saw any of the english guys train back then ,I wish I had , they seem to get after it .........Fisher trained hard ....not crazy strong, but intense ....Milos and sonny looked great all the time and did high volume when I saw them multiple times .....most guys trained the same ....mod volume and intensity ......and they all were strong .....the biggest tended to be the strongest as well , but not always .........No one worked out like Dante had us doing ......and it was fun being different ....
